ci: pull the BuildKit frontend from the mirror too
Run #70's logs still showed one Docker Hub reference, from the one place
that does not look like an image reference:

  #2 resolve image config for docker-image://docker.io/docker/dockerfile:1.10

`# syntax=` is an image pull. Same mirror, same digest, and pinned now —
it was the only unpinned image left in the build.

# syntax=mirror.gcr.io/docker/dockerfile:1.10@sha256:865e5dd094beca432e8c0a1d5e1c465db5f998dca4e439981029b3b81fb39ed5
#
# svcforge worker. Build from the REPO ROOT:
# docker buildx build -f services/worker/Dockerfile -t svcforge/worker:dev .
#
# The only service that shells out to helm, so the only one carrying that binary
# binaries. They are copied from pinned images rather than curl'd, so the version is a
# reviewable line in a Dockerfile instead of a network call at build time.
FROM mirror.gcr.io/library/python:3.14-slim@sha256:cea0e6040540fb2b965b6e7fb5ffa00871e632eef63719f0ea54bca189ce14a6 AS builder
COPY --from=ghcr.io/astral-sh/uv:0.11.29@sha256:eb2843a1e56fd9e30c7276ce1a52cba86e64c7b385f5e3279a0e08e02dd058fc /uv /usr/local/bin/uv
ENV UV_COMPILE_BYTECODE=1 UV_LINK_MODE=copy UV_PYTHON_DOWNLOADS=never
WORKDIR /app
COPY pyproject.toml uv.lock ./
COPY libs/svcforge_core/pyproject.toml libs/svcforge_core/
RUN --mount=type=cache,target=/root/.cache/uv \
uv sync --frozen --no-dev --no-editable \
--no-install-project --no-install-package svcforge-core
COPY libs/ libs/
COPY services/worker/ services/worker/
COPY catalog.yaml ./
RUN --mount=type=cache,target=/root/.cache/uv \
uv sync --frozen --no-dev --no-editable && \
/app/.venv/bin/python -c 'import svcforge_core, sys; \
p = svcforge_core.__file__; \
sys.exit(0) if "site-packages" in p else sys.exit("not a wheel install: " + p)'
# --- runtime --------------------------------------------------------------------------
FROM mirror.gcr.io/library/python:3.14-slim@sha256:cea0e6040540fb2b965b6e7fb5ffa00871e632eef63719f0ea54bca189ce14a6
ARG BUILD_SHA=unknown
LABEL org.opencontainers.image.title="svcforge-worker" \
org.opencontainers.image.source="https://gitea.oci-oci.duckdns.org/gitea_admin/svcforge" \
org.opencontainers.image.revision="${BUILD_SHA}"
RUN useradd -u 10001 -m -s /usr/sbin/nologin svcforge
WORKDIR /app
COPY --from=builder --chown=10001:10001 /app /app
# helm 3.21.3, not 3.16.2. 3.16.2 was built with Go 1.22.9 and carries CRITICAL
# CVE-2025-68121 (crypto/tls) and CVE-2026-33186 (grpc), plus HIGH CVE-2026-35469
# (spdystream, fixed in 0.5.1) — trivy fails the build on them and is right to.
# Deliberately 3.x: helm 4 is a breaking change and is not a CVE fix.
COPY --from=mirror.gcr.io/alpine/helm:3.21.3@sha256:35da09ba0716fc7c3cd63b6b31ee380a9c7662e95f29ab0e4ae962420afd315b /usr/bin/helm /usr/local/bin/helm
ENV PATH="/app/.venv/bin:$PATH" \
PYTHONUNBUFFERED=1 \
PYTHONDONTWRITEBYTECODE=1 \
HELM_CACHE_HOME=/tmp/helm/cache \
HELM_CONFIG_HOME=/tmp/helm/config \
HELM_DATA_HOME=/tmp/helm/data
USER 10001
ENTRYPOINT ["python", "-m", "services.worker.main"]
